Nicolás Maduro Faces Court in New York After Capture
Nicolás Maduro, Former Leader of Venezuela
Nicolás Maduro, the former president of Venezuela, made his first court appearance in New York following his capture by American forces in Caracas on January 3. Maduro and his wife, Cilia Flores, were brought before the judge in handcuffs, both on their hands and feet. They are facing charges that include narcoterrorism. Both entered pleas of "not guilty." BBC reporter Madeline Halpert was present in the courtroom as the former president addressed the judge.
